The cheapest way to get from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am is to bus which costs €11 - €19 and takes 2h 24m.
The fastest way to get from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am is to drive which takes 1h 23m and costs €17 - €25.
No, there is no direct bus from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am. However, there are services departing from De Efteling and arriving at Amsterdam, Rokin via Amsterdam, Station Bijlmer ArenA.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 24m.
The distance between Kaatsheuvel and Amsterdam is 123 km. The road distance is 97 km.
The best way to get from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am without a car is to line 301 bus and train which takes 1h 54m and costs €15 - €30.
It takes approximately 1h 54m to get from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am, including transfers.
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am bus services, operated by FlixBus, depart from De Efteling station.
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am bus services, operated by FlixBus, arrive at Amsterdam Bijlmer Arena station.
Yes, the driving distance between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am is 97 km. It takes approximately 1h 23m to drive from Kaatsheuvel to Amsterdam.
